What Does Pluto Represent in Astrology?

In astrology, Pluto is associated with transformation, power, regeneration, and the subconscious mind. It’s considered one of the outer planets and is often linked with deep psychological processes and profound changes, including repressed emotions, fears, and desires. Pluto’s placement in the birth chart can indicate areas where there may be hidden motivations or unconscious patterns at play.

2nd House Astrology

In astrology, the 2nd house is one of the twelve houses in a natal chart, representing various aspects related to personal resources, possessions, values, and self-worth. It reflects how an individual earns, spends, and manages their money, as well as their attitudes toward financial security and abundance. Beyond tangible possessions, the 2nd house also governs personal resources and assets, including investments, savings, and possessions of value. It reflects one’s capacity to accumulate and manage resources effectively.

Depending on the planets and aspects present in the 2nd house, it can also reveal attitudes toward materialism, extravagance, or frugality. It reflects one’s relationship with material possessions and the role they play in shaping identity and fulfillment.

2nd House Pluto Meaning

Pluto’s placement in the 2nd house of the natal chart carries significant implications for an individual’s relationship with material possessions, resources, values, and self-worth. Here are some key interpretations of Pluto in the 2nd house:

  1. Intense Relationship with Money and Resources: Pluto’s presence in the 2nd house often indicates a profound intensity and complexity regarding finances, possessions, and material security. Individuals with this placement may experience significant fluctuations in their financial situations, including periods of loss and subsequent regeneration.
  2. Transformation of Values: Pluto’s influence in the 2nd house suggests a deep-seated transformation in one’s value system. This could manifest as a radical shift in personal priorities, beliefs about wealth and abundance, or attitudes towards material possessions. Individuals may undergo intense experiences that force them to reassess their relationship with money and resources.
  3. Power Dynamics in Financial Matters: Pluto in the 2nd house can indicate power struggles or issues of control concerning financial matters. Individuals with this placement may experience challenges related to sharing resources, joint finances, or inheritance. They may also exhibit a strong desire to gain control over their financial situation or to exert power through wealth accumulation.
  4. Obsession with Material Security: There may be an obsessive quality to the individual’s pursuit of material security and financial stability. They might feel a constant drive to amass wealth or accumulate possessions as a means of gaining a sense of control or security in their lives.
  5. Transformation of Self-Worth: Pluto’s placement in the 2nd house can signify a profound journey of self-discovery and transformation regarding self-worth and self-esteem. Individuals may confront deep-seated insecurities or fears related to their value as individuals, ultimately undergoing a process of empowerment and self-acceptance.
  6. Rebirth through Financial Challenges: While Pluto in the 2nd house can bring about intense financial challenges, these experiences often serve as catalysts for personal growth and transformation. Individuals may need to confront their deepest fears and insecurities surrounding money and possessions in order to emerge stronger and more resilient.

In Synastry

When one person’s Pluto aligns with another person’s 2nd house in synastry, it indicates that financial matters will play a huge role in the bond between the two people, especially as the relation evolves and transforms. In other words, both partners will likely see their relationship evolve through financial challenges to develop into a stronger bond.
